You look me in the eyes it’s there you see shadows of lies behind. Behind tears pain makeup and a few smiling masks. You’ll find the true me find my true past. It’s lies that I’ve told everyone else. I’ve told them so long I believe them myself. Taking back the masks makeup is all you see. I can't believe it is that really me? Eyeliner, lipgloss, mascara and more, cover up everything. Every single pore. Wiping off the makeup all you see is pain. A broken woman drowning in rain looking past the pain, a face covered by tears. Grief builds up over the years. A four-year-old ball of sunshine grew dim. Grew used to the years she let no one in. These harmful feelings I have repressed, no one knows that I am depressed.
